I'm not sure what it is, but the hammer spring in xtreme-s trigger group is stiffer than a wilson 12lbs. I assume the hammer spring from that trigger group is the same as what comes with the 92x performance.
Maybe try a regular beretta trigger instead of the short reach. I feel the short reach is too short in single action -- my index finger ends up hitting the frame before the sear can release the hammer.
The dimensions are the same but I can't seat CCI SRP below flush in 9mm consistently without having to crush it like revolver reloaders. I think the hardness have something to do with it. I settled with just flush with CCI SRP & it still works fine.
I'm able to seat federal SRP below flush with normal pressure.
